MySQL作為一種流行的關系型數據庫管理系統,一直是Web應用程序開發者使用最廣泛的工具之一。MySQL具有可靠性高、免費開源、易于使用等特點,其各種版本也在不斷更新升級中。那么關于MySQL的哪個版本更好呢?接下來我們看一看。
MySQL的最新版本是8.0版,與7.0版相比,它具有更好的性能和安全性,同時還引入了一些新的功能和改進。例如,在8.0中增加了InnoDB聚集索引,這使得在大型表中查詢性能得到了提升。此外,8.0版本還為MySQL增加了Data Dictionary(數據字典),這使得開發者更容易地了解和管理MySQL的內部結構。
雖然MySQL 8.0是最新版本,但并不是所有的應用程序都需要這么新的版本。根據使用場景的不同,不同的版本都有適合自己的場景,比如,在大規模Web應用程序項目中,如果要求高性能和高可用性,那么MySQL 5.7就是更好的選擇。因為MySQL 5.7穩定性更高,對于高并發應用也更加友好。
SELECT company_name, COUNT(*) AS num
FROM employee
GROUP BY company_name
HAVING COUNT(*) >10;
總結來說,MySQL的版本選擇應該根據具體應用場景進行權衡。如果是新的項目或者要求高性能和高安全性,那么8.0版本是不錯的選擇;而傳統項目或者高并發應用程序則更適合選擇5.7版本。選擇合適版本的MySQL,能夠更好地滿足業務需求,提高開發效率。
上一篇dockeropc